Transaction 6ec1f1507299e990d477f6c8f91221c48d00747f9be2ee7a751343cfe6dc9421

9 Input
2 Outputs
  • 6ec1f1507299e990d477f6c8f91221c48d00747f9be2ee7a751343cfe6dc9421:0
  • value  27810000
    address  3Mt6oaR78KMh3UVPVcWJzjUHR3ukDkLJH7
  • 6ec1f1507299e990d477f6c8f91221c48d00747f9be2ee7a751343cfe6dc9421:1
  • value  403409
    address  3AnZFXJBXFwirqrpPCpBASRURo3sGRTVMW